St. Gregory of Narek Sunday School Celebrates Its Graduates

On Sunday, May 18, the StGregory of Narek Sunday School community gathered for a heartfelt Closing Ceremony and Graduation, marking the conclusion of another blessed year of learning and faith formation. Presided over by Yn. Naira Azatyan-Sargsyan, the program honored the dedication of students, teachers, and parents alike.

Every student received a participation certificate as a sign of encouragement and achievement. The ceremony reached its joyful peak as four devoted graduates—Mher Poghosyan, Ashot Davtyan, Narek Yeranossian, and Mane Sargsyan—were presented with Graduation Diplomas and personalized Bibles gifted by His Grace Bishop Mesrop, Primate of the Eastern Diocese.

The event featured inspiring speeches by the graduates, Sunday School Superintendent Yn. Naira, proud parents, and Pastor Fr. Hratch, each offering words of gratitude, reflection, and encouragement. Yn. Naira spoke passionately about carrying the light of faith beyond the classroom, reminding graduates that their spiritual journey continues as a witness to God’s love in the world.

Everyone enjoyed a delicious luncheon, graciously hosted by the Sunday School, which brought together families and friends to celebrate this meaningful milestone.
